A couple of questions:

1.  Cards must be sleeved, but what about cards that are not in the deck proper, e.g. missions, locations, characters, etc.?  (Never played competitively, so I've no idea of the standard.

2.  To be clear, the only difference for the max 6 is the team can't have a printed grid above 6, correct?

Jack

Only the deck is required to be sleeved, other cards do not have to be.

Max 6 is the regular game but the characters on your team cannot have a 7 or 8 in their grid.
This implies that Beyonder, Tiffany, Captain Mar-Vell and Reyes are allowed. The battlesite, if any, do not apply to these restrictions.

More information about  the DC tournament, I figured it would be as such but avoided speculation:
Quote from: Larry Van EttenAlso, the Saturday tourney (optional) will be a DC starter deck tourney.
Single elimination. The winner of each battle wins the others deck. They can use the additional cards to build a new deck each round. The game goes until there is only one winner - who gets all the cards.
